I was reminded today of a spooky experience that I'd forgot about concerning my old dog.

I had a Springer Spaniel called Sam all my life until he died when I was about 12-ish, he was 15. Very sad! Anyway, at night he used to sleep on a huge dog bed/cushion by the back door and the bed would snuggle nicely into the alcove of the door and stop just before the bin in the kitchen.

Now everytime he would move in his slip, turn around etc the bed would make this very distinct tapping/rattling noise on the bin which was metal. If I heard it now I'd recognise it as that sound instantly.

Anyway long story short, one evening a few weeks after he died I was home alone watching wrestling videos on my own, parents had gone to the supermarket. I was well into watching it when I heard THE NOISE. Not thinking I didn't react until later on when I thought about it. My Mum was like "aww he came back to tell you he's okay!" or that he'd come to say goodbye, bless.
